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gTilt and Turn Windows

Tilt-turn windows are akin to doors that open and provide numerous advanced features, such as healthy ventilation, unobstructed view and easy cleaning. They are available in a wide range of sizes and can be utilized across all floors of your home.

As opposed to casement windows, tilt and turn windows are able to open inwards which shields the window's hardware from weather damage. They also offer more design options.

Security

Windows can be opened and tilted like doors or can be tilted inward for ventilation with a simple turn of the handle. They provide excellent burglary resistance and provide a superior level of protection from harsh weather conditions. They also conform to European RC2 burglar-proof requirements, and are superior to North American casement windows.

Their multi-locking system is the secret to their extraordinary security. It locks the window sash to its the frame. When the window door repairs locks glass hinges is locked in the closed position, at the very least five steel locking pins slide into metal rails within the frame and then pull the vent shut, preventing any unauthorized access to your home. This kind of system is also more secure from elements than sliding hinge mechanisms that are used in crank-style casement windows because they don't expose the hardware to rain or sun which could cause damage over time.

One of the key features of tilt-and-turn windows is that they do not open outwards. This eliminates the possibility of wind forcing them to open. This could be an issue with some larger windows, particularly those on higher floors where the force of wind can be quite intense. Opening outwards is also dangerous for those with limited mobility.

Maintenance

They resemble casement windows, but they feature hinges that let them to open in two different ways. They can be opened from the bottom in a manner similar as a normal casement window for ventilation or turned inward like a door on side hinges to make cleaning easier. This makes them ideal for modern homes, allowing the requirements for egress and fire regulations for bedrooms or basements.

Incorrect installation can cause issues, even though tilt and turn windows are not inherently defective. This can include problems with smooth shutting and opening, air or moisture leakages, and hardware problems. Most of these problems are easily corrected by adjusting your sash and following the proper opening procedures.

The tilt and turn window mechanism is hidden inside the frame profile rather than being visible as it is with traditional casement windows. This protects the mechanism from the elements and ensures it is running smoothly over time. They are also less vulnerable to clogging by dust, which can cause jams and snags to other types window hinges. The tilt and turn design also offers better resistance to weather conditions especially when it is it is opened in the tilt position.
